Output 8efb4d16728ff326c0470b41fb519bcd960917e1b70a06a592f23f92fe70b42d:1

value
99954898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87e2c7452d1cb0d61b370be07771f799e521b0e9 OP_EQUAL
address
MLHf8Ad5VVmypwduPscvswET3A4YULTWKu
transaction
8efb4d16728ff326c0470b41fb519bcd960917e1b70a06a592f23f92fe70b42d
spent
true